How To Choose The Best Carrier Oil For Castor Oil
Castor oil alone can be too viscous for even application, which is why selecting a carrier with the right molecular weight and absorption profile is critical. The wrong mix either sits on the surface or fails to deliver the castor oil’s active compounds deep enough into the follicle or dermis.
Viscosity and Absorption Rate
The primary job of any carrier when blending with castor oil is to lower the overall thickness without stripping the therapeutic properties. A carrier like fractionated coconut oil (MCT) stays liquid at room temperature and penetrates rapidly, making it ideal for scalp massages where you want quick absorption. Jojoba oil, molecularly similar to human sebum, regulates oil production and absorbs at a moderate pace — better for facial applications where you want a non-greasy finish.
Purity and Processing Method
Cold-pressed, hexane-free oils retain more of their natural fatty acids and antioxidants compared to solvent-extracted alternatives. USDA Organic certification adds a layer of assurance that the oil is free from pesticides and synthetic additives. For a carrier oil meant to dilute castor oil for regular use on skin and hair, choosing a minimally processed product prevents introducing irritants that could counteract castor oil’s anti-inflammatory benefits.
